Solve 6 +5(m + 1) = 26.

Answer:

m = 3

Step-by-step explanation:

First, distribute the 5 to the values inside the parentheses.

6 + 5m + 5 = 26

Combine like terms: 5m + 11 = 26

Then, you want to isolate the variable so you subtract 11 from both sides because what you do on one side must be done to the other.

5m + 11 - 11 = 5m

26 - 11 = 15

5m = 15

Then divide both sides by 5.

5m / 5 = m

15 / 5 = 3

m = 3

Which of the sequences is an arithmetic sequence?
Bogdan [553]
<h3>Answer: Choice A</h3>

This is because we're adding -6 to each term, i.e. subtracting 6 from each term, to get the next term

  • -2+(-6) = -8
  • -8+(-6) = -14
  • -14+(-6) = -20
  • -20+(-6) = -26

and so on. The gap between adjacent terms is the same width. We say that the common difference is d = -6.
